задача на работу с файлами Need Help (паскаль)

Ответить
msblast
Сообщения: 10
Зарегистрирован: 15 май 2007, 19:06

Файл каталог файлов
Структура записи
- имя файла (8 знаков)
- спецификация (3 знака)
- дата создания:
день (2 знака)
месяц (2 знака)
год (2 знака)

1. Записи упорядочены по именам файлов.
2. Найдите такие файлы, которые есть в трёх модификациях со спецификациями .pas, .obj, .exe
3. Выберите и запишите в отдельный файл сведения о файлах, размер которых превышает заданное число объектов.
4. Перепишите его в отдельный файл, упорядочив записи по количеству блоков.
5. Занесите в отдельный файл записи о файлах с заданной спецификацией.
6. Занесите в отдельный файл записи о файлах с заданным именем.
7. Занесите в отдельный файл записи о файлах созданных ранее указанной даты.



я не понял :
1)
3. Выберите и запишите в отдельный файл сведения о файлах, размер которых превышает заданное число объектов.
4. Перепишите его в отдельный файл, упорядочив записи по количеству блоков.
Что есть обьект, и что есть блок?
2) как в Паскале прочитать директорию с файлами?
BBB
Сообщения: 1298
Зарегистрирован: 27 дек 2005, 13:37

msblast писал(а):2) как в Паскале прочитать директорию с файлами?
Функции FindFirst, FindNext. Во встроенном Help-е Паскаля на эти функции есть пример использования.
msblast
Сообщения: 10
Зарегистрирован: 15 май 2007, 19:06

ненашел таких, хоть убей
Хыиуду
Сообщения: 2442
Зарегистрирован: 06 мар 2005, 21:03
Откуда: Москва
Контактная информация:

Открываешь Паскаль, пишешь findfirst, наводишь на него курсор, нажимаешь Ctrl+F1
Искусство программирования - заставить компьютер делать все то, что вам делать лень.
Для "спасибо" есть кнопка "Спасибо" в виде звездочки внизу под ником автора поста.
Ответить